Nike just unveiled its first sneaker that you can slip on hands-free — take a look at the $120 shoes – Business Insider Australia
Nike on Monday announced its first hands-free sneaker, the Go FlyEase.

- Nike on Monday unveiled its first hands-free sneaker, the $US120 Go FlyEase.
- People can slip the shoes on and off without bending down thanks to a “bi-stable hinge,” Nike said.
- The sneakers will be available to certain people on February 15 and to the public later this year.
